I was looking for a rugged slipon workboot.
I'm a union carpenter and need something tough that will last.
These boots look nice but are very thin (no good in cold weather) and will not stand up to the beating I put on work boots.
Maybe they are good for light duty work but not construction work.

These boots provide great cushioning - walking is very comfortable. I bought them on another site and after a few weeks left a very positive review. Then? Then the inside of the left boot started falling apart and it made it nearly impossible to get the boot off without using a shoehorn. The shoehorn is needed to hold the heel liner and the rest of the lining in place because it has separated from the rest of the boot, and immediately bunches up and prevents you from getting the boot off / getting your foot out. Poor quality of construction. Hugely disappointed customer here.
